Tuesday, May 24, 2011


Queen Elizabeth Schools Obama

Oh dear, this is embarrassing.

First Netanyahu puts President Obama a series of primers, including that face to face history lesson on live TV around the world; then Obama embarrasses himself twice on the same day at Buckingham Palace, the second of which plays out here:

America: This is your President?

